7:00pm          The Comic (1969) with introduction by Chuck Koplinski



A fictionalized account of the rise and fall of a silent film comic, Billy Bright, played by Dick Van Dyke, The Comic (1969) is also loosely based on the life of Buster Keaton. Beginning with Bright’s funeral, as he speaks from beyond the grave in a bitter tone about his fate, the film takes us through Bright’s fame, his ruin, and his fall, as a lonely, bitter old man unable to reconcile his life's disappointments.

2:00pm          Mary Poppins (1964) Family Matinee Movie


           
A spoiled and bored upper crust Edwardian English family, the Banks, has their world turned upside down by a magical nanny (Mary Poppins) and her friend Bert (Dick Van Dyke) who teach them how to enjoy life. As a live action and animation musical, Mary Poppins has both comedy and pathos and showcases imaginative scenes that are wonderful for adults and children alike. 7:00pm          Cold Turkey (1971) with introduction by Dann Gire 



Hoping for positive publicity, a tobacco company offers $25 million to any American town that quits smoking for 30 days. Amidst a media frenzy, Eagle Rock, Iowa and its spiritual leader, Reverend Clayton Brooks (Dick Van Dyke) accept the challenge while the company's PR man tries to sabotage the effort.
